Unboxing & authenticity checks

Inspect your Ledger device package carefully. Only purchase from the official Ledger shop. Look for tamper-evident seals and official documentation. Contact Ledger Support if anything seems suspicious. Security guidance is available at ledger.com/security.

Install Ledger Live

Ledger Live manages device firmware, app installation, and wallet accounts. Download from the official page: ledger.com/ledger-live. Ledger Live guides you through device initialization or recovery securely.

Initialize or recover

You can set up your device as new or restore a previous wallet. If initializing, your device will display a 24-word recovery phrase — record it offline and safely. If recovering, input your recovery phrase on the device only. Never type it into a computer or phone. Learn more at ledger.com/learn.

Firmware updates & app installation

Ledger Live ensures your device firmware is signed and updated safely. Install coin apps via Ledger Live to manage different cryptocurrencies. Official guide: firmware updates.

Protecting your recovery phrase

Store your 24-word recovery phrase securely offline. Use a metal backup for added safety. Never share it online — Ledger will never ask for it. For guidance, refer to Support and Security pages.

Third-party wallet integration

Ledger is compatible with wallets like MetaMask and Electrum. Install required apps on the device first and verify addresses on-device before approving any transaction. Learn about compatibility: ledger.com/compatibility.

Privacy & advanced settings

Ledger Live queries nodes to show balances. For privacy, consider personal nodes or privacy-preserving backends. Explore advanced guides at Learn.

Troubleshooting

Device not detected? Check USB connection, cable, unlock device, update Ledger Live, or check Bluetooth for Nano X. Support center: support.

Security checklist

Buy from official shop
Avoid second-hand devices.
Never disclose recovery phrase
Ledger will never ask for it.
Use Ledger Live
Official updater for firmware and apps.
Verify on-device
Check addresses before approving sends.
